Abstract :
An electronic counter-countermeasure (ECCM) signal processor for space-based radar (SBR) is described. An adaptive nulling block using auxiliary antennas cancels jammers. The weights on the auxiliary channels are computed using the normal equations. Adaptive nulling is combined with displaced phase center antenna (DPCA) processing to jointly cancel both jamming and clutter. Nulling is followed by sidelobe blanking, which detects and removes pulse jammers. The processor is implemented on commercial DSP hardware, and runs at SBR real-time rates.
